School bells are ringing all over East Texas, signaling the end of summer and the start of a new school year.

With school back in session, those amber school zone lights that have been dormant for the last three months have all been reactivated this morning and will remain active for the next nine months for the 2015-2016 school year.

Those all to familiar lights could lead to some big fines if you don't abide by their flashing warning. Get caught speeding in a school zone and get ready to pay a hefty fine and if you're on a cell phone, well, you could go ahead and get ready to hand over up to an additional $200.

Flashing yellow lights equal school zone. Slow down to posted speed, get off your cell phone and watch out for kids crossing the road because they're not going to be looking out for you.
